So, Here's to the lost soul The one who wants to go right but goes left For no apparent reason The one who dreams high and stumbles upon the depth The one who is as tangled as the knotted Earphone The one who wants to go out and Stay at home, the same time The one who wonders why they didn't chose the former or the later and vice versa Upon choosing the former and the later And regrets anyway Here's to the one who have no idea what they are doing with life The one who wants to do better But does the same thing everyday The one who feels Entire world is running infront of their eyes And they are bounded just like trees from their roots Here's to the one who don't know who they are Or why they are Or What they are Here's to the lost soul Who often don't see the charisma of their own reflection Because They are so lost In their own thought In their own world
